After a series of local owners it was bought by media giant Clear Channel Communication in 1997. Later the fund expanded to include college scholarships, establish boy clubs, provide 125 Little League Teams to Memphis and neighboring communities, and help provide low cost supplemental housing (Wilson). When hewould usually open phone lines for listeners, the station continued to play music. The station had a strong influence on music, hiring musicians early in their careers, and playing their music to an audience that reached through the Mississippi Delta to the Gulf Coast. A.C. Williams, a former disc jockey for the station, helped create the Goodwill Fund in 1954, and the station's identification announcement became, Youre Listening to 50,000 Watts of Goodwill, W-D-I-A Memphis.. Though the on-air talent was black, as were the artists whose music they played, ownership remained white. [6] In June 1954 WDIA was licensed to increase its power from 250 to 50,000 watts, which meant moving to 1070kHz. America's first black radio station, playing classic R&B. Moreover, the station owners established several other successful rhythm-and-blues outlets, including KDIA in Oakland, California. The station started the WDIA Goodwill Fund to help and empower black communities. degree in English literature from Rust College in Holly Springs, Mississippi, and her M.S. . I had a drug problem back then, OJay openly admitted. Influencing every black radio station to follow, WDIA assigned itself the moniker the Mother Station of Negroes. It earned the nickname the Goodwill Station as well because it broadcast public service bulletins announcing employment opportunities, missing children, social service agency information, and the like at the behest of its listening audience.
